07/02/14 Lester Potts

Yes the 42 is a former Bill Hence 421 driven by Laudan Potts . This was the car my dad won with the first night they brought it out it wasn't even painted yet it was a brown primer. The following year Bill Hence made a new car and sold this car to Bill Beasley and his dad. There was one night during the season my drove this car for the Beasley's and finished second with it my dad really liked this car and always said Bill sold the wrong car to the Beasley's .
